Output 39b821b4bb90778f2a7aa6b08286ebfb6cb67273c083fc4e643b7482a0d8b805:0

value
3294893
script pubkey
OP_0 OP_PUSHBYTES_20 eb70428f318bafdf8e51f5682e5f9bc0e4bff312
address
bc1qadcy9re33whalrj3745zuhumcrjtlucje676az
transaction
39b821b4bb90778f2a7aa6b08286ebfb6cb67273c083fc4e643b7482a0d8b805
confirmations
151704
spent
true